I tried again. This time journalctl -xe throws this useful error:
mysqld[23361]: mysqld: Can't read dir of '/etc/mysql/conf.d/' (Errcode: 2 - No 
such file or directory)

Easy fix now:
sudo cp -r /etc/mysql/mysql.conf.d/ /etc/mysql/conf.d/

Successfully migrated databases to 5.7
